Commercial Laws and Regulations

In Oregon, cities with populations of 4000 or more are required to provide an opportunity to recycle to residents and businesses. The requirements are in statute and rule and can be found below. In addition, businesses that use or manufacture rigid plastic containers, glass, or newsprint have additional requirements.

Call your local solid waste agency for information about any additional solid waste ordinances that might have an effect on your business' waste reduction program (see Who to Call). Some local ordinances require businesses to recycle and others place specific requirements on collectors.
